download pdf in mvc : Convert pdf to single page tiff control application system azure html web page console Illustrator-Scripting-Reference-AppleScript15-part265

C
HAPTER
1: AppleScript Objects
PNG24 export options     151
PNG24 export options
Options that can be supplied when exporting a document as a PNG file with 24-bit color. See the 
export
command for additional details.
This class contains properties that specify options to be used when exporting a document as a PNG24 file. 
PNG24
export
options
can only be supplied in conjunction with the 
export
command. It is not possible 
to get or create a 
PNG24
export
options
object.
PNG24 export options object properties
Property
Value type
What it is
antialiasing
boolean
If 
true
, the resulting image should be anti-aliased. Default:
true
artboard clipping
boolean
If 
true
, the resulting image should be clipped to the artboard. 
Default: 
false
horizontal 
scaling
real
The percent horizontal scaling factor to apply to the resulting 
image. Range: 0.0 to 100.0. Default: 100.0
matte
boolean
If 
true
, the artboard should be matted with a color. Default:
true
matte color
RGB color 
info
The color to use when matting the artboard. 
Default: {255.0, 255.0, 255.0}
saving as HTML
boolean
If 
true
, the resulting image be saved with an accompanying 
HTML file. Default: 
false
transparency
boolean
If 
true
, the resulting image should use transparency. 
Default:
true
vertical scaling
real
The percentage vertical scaling factor to apply to the resulting 
image. Range: 0.0 to 100.0. Default: 100.0
Convert pdf to single page tiff - software Library dll:C# PDF Convert to Tiff SDK: Convert PDF to tiff images in C#.net, ASP.NET MVC, Ajax, WinForms, WPF
Online C# Tutorial for How to Convert PDF File to Tiff Image File
www.rasteredge.com
Convert pdf to single page tiff - software Library dll:VB.NET PDF Convert to Tiff SDK: Convert PDF to tiff images in vb.net, ASP.NET MVC, Ajax, WinForms, WPF
Free VB.NET Guide to Render and Convert PDF Document to TIFF
www.rasteredge.com
C
HAPTER
1: AppleScript Objects
PNG24 export options     152
Exporting to PNG24
This handler saves all files in a folder as 24-bit PNG files in HTML format scaled to 50%. Note that the 
class
property is specified in the record to ensure that Illustrator can determine the save option class.
-- Opens files from a predefined source folder in Illustrator
-- then exports them to a predefined destination folder in the chosen format
-- fileList is a list of file names in the source folder
-- filePath is the full path to the source folder
-- destFolder is an alias to a folder where the files are to be saved
on SaveFilesAsPNG24(fileList, filePath, destFolder)
set destPath to destFolder as string
set fileCount to count of fileList
if fileCount > 0 then
repeat with i from 1 to fileCount
set fileName to item i of fileList
set fullPath to filePath & fileName
set newFilePath to destPath & fileName & ".png"
tell application "Adobe Illustrator"
open POSIX file fullPath as alias without dialogs
export current document to file newFilePath as PNG24 ¬
with options {class:PNG24 export options ¬
, horizontal scaling:50.0 ¬
, vertical scaling:50.0 ¬
, saving as HTML:false}
close current document saving no
end tell
end repeat
end if
end SaveFilesAsPNG24
software Library dll:Online Convert PDF file to Tiff. Best free online PDF Tif
C# developers can render and convert PDF document to TIFF image file with no loss in original file quality. Both single page and multi-page Tiff image files
www.rasteredge.com
software Library dll:VB.NET PDF Page Delete Library: remove PDF pages in vb.net, ASP.
Able to remove a single page from adobe PDF document in VB.NET. using RasterEdge. XDoc.PDF; How to VB.NET: Delete a Single PDF Page from PDF File.
www.rasteredge.com
C
HAPTER
1: AppleScript Objects
polygon     153
polygon
A class used to create a multi-sided path item in an Illustrator document. This object is available only in the 
context of a 
make
command, which creates an instance of the 
path
item
class. This special class allows you 
to quickly create complex path items using the properties provided. Properties usually associated with 
path items, such as 
fill
color
, can also be specified at the time of creation.
If you do not specify any properties when making a new polygon, default values are used. 
polygon object properties
polygon object commands
make
Create a polygon
-- Make an octagon in document 1
tell application "Adobe Illustrator"
set pathRef to make new polygon in document 1 with properties ¬
{center point:{200.0, 200.0}, radius:40.0, sides:8}
end tell
Property
Value type
What it is
center point
fixed point
Write-once. The center point for the polygon. Default: {200.0, 300.0}
radius
real
Write-once. The radius of the polygon’s points. Default: 50.0
reversed
boolean
Write-once. If 
true
, the polygon path is reversed. Default: 
false
sides
integer
(unsigned)
Write-once. The number of sides for the polygon. Default: 8
software Library dll:C# PDF Page Delete Library: remove PDF pages in C#.net, ASP.NET
application. Able to remove a single page from PDF document. Ability Demo Code: How to Delete a Single PDF Page from PDF File in C#.NET. How to
www.rasteredge.com
software Library dll:C# HTML5 PDF Viewer SDK to view PDF document online in C#.NET
PDF pages, VB.NET comment annotate PDF, VB.NET delete PDF pages, VB.NET convert PDF to SVG. Users can view PDF document in single page or continue
www.rasteredge.com
C
HAPTER
1: AppleScript Objects
postscript options     154
postscript options
Specifies the options for printing to a PostScript language printer or image setter when printing a 
document with the print
command. 
postscript options object properties
Property
Value type
What it is
binary printing
boolean
If 
true
, job is to be printed in binary mode. Default: 
false
compatible shading
boolean
If 
true
, use PostScript language level 1 compatible 
gradient and gradient mesh printing. Default: 
false
force continuous tone
boolean
If 
true
, force continuous tone. Default: 
false
image compression
Valid values:
JPEG
none
RLE
The image compression type. Default: 
none
negative printing
boolean
If 
true
, print in negative mode. Default: 
false
PostScript
Valid values:
level 1
level 2
level 3
The PostScript language level. Default: 
level
2
shading resolution
real
The shading resolution in dots per inch. 
Range: 1.0 to 9600.0;.Default: 300.0
software Library dll:C# Create PDF from Tiff Library to convert tif images to PDF in C#
Similarly, Tiff image with single page or multiple pages is supported. Description: Convert to PDF and save it on the disk. Parameters:
www.rasteredge.com
software Library dll:VB.NET PDF- View PDF Online with VB.NET HTML5 PDF Viewer
csv to PDF, C#.NET convert PDF to svg, C#.NET convert PDF to text, C#.NET convert PDF to images Users can view PDF document in single page or continue
www.rasteredge.com
C
HAPTER
1: AppleScript Objects
PPD file     155
PPD file
Associates properties with a PPD file to be used in printing to a PostScript language printer or image setter. 
The properties are not available unless a document is open.
PPD file object properties
Save to PPD
-- Make a new document
-- Get the PPDs
-- Get the name, PS Level, and file path of the first PPD
-- Make a new text frame with the PPD info as its contents
tell application "Adobe Illustrator"
activate
make new document
set PPDFiles to PPDs
set PPDName to name of item 1 of PPDFiles
set PPDProperties to get properties of item 1 of PPDFiles
set PPDLevel to language level of PPDProperties
set PPDPath to file path of PPDProperties
set textContents to PPDName & return & "PostScript Level " & PPDLevel & return & "PPD 
Path: " & PPDPath as string
make new text frame in document 1 with properties {contents:textContents, 
position:{20, 600}}
end tell
Property
Value type
What it is
name
Unicode text
The PPD model name.
properties
PPD properties
The PPD file information.
software Library dll:C# Word - Convert Word to TIFF in C#.NET
VB.NET How-to, VB.NET PDF, VB.NET Word control, C# developers can render and convert Word document Both single page and multi-page Tiff image files are acceptable
www.rasteredge.com
software Library dll:VB.NET Image: Multi-page TIFF Editor SDK; Process TIFF in VB.NET
this VB.NET multi-page TIFF imaging SDK owns rich APIs, using which developers can easily load, save, view, edit, annotate, manipulate, convert and compress
www.rasteredge.com
C
HAPTER
1: AppleScript Objects
PPD properties     156
PPD properties
Specifies information about a PPD file.
PPD properties object properties
Using PPD information
-- Make a new document
-- Get the PPD files
-- Get name, PS Level, screens, screen spot functions, and file path of first PPD
-- For each screen, get the name, angle, and frequency
-- For each spot function, get the name and the function
-- Make a new text frame with the PPD info as its contents
tell application "Adobe Illustrator"
activate
make new document
set PPDFiles to PPDs
set PPDName to name of item 1 of PPDFiles
set PPDProperties to get properties of item 1 of PPDFiles
set PPDLevel to language level of PPDProperties
set PPDPath to file path of PPDProperties
set PPDScreens to screens of PPDProperties
set screensText to "Screens" & return
repeat with PPDScreen in PPDScreens
set PPDScreenName to name of PPDScreen
set PPDScreenAngle to angle of properties of PPDScreen
set PPFScreenFrequency to frequency of properties of PPDScreen
set screensText to screensText & tab & PPDScreenName & ¬
" - Angle: " & PPDScreenAngle & ", Frequency: " & PPFScreenFrequency ¬
& return as string
end repeat
set PPDSpotFunctions to spot functions of PPDProperties
set PPDSpotFunctionText to "Spot Functions" & return
repeat with PPDSpotFunction in PPDSpotFunctions
set PPDSpotFunctionName to name of PPDSpotFunction
set PPDSpotFunctionTX to spot function of PPDSpotFunction
set PPDSpotFunctionText to PPDSpotFunctionText & tab ¬
& PPDSpotFunctionName & ": " & PPDSpotFunctionTX ¬
& return as string
end repeat
set textContents to PPDName & return & ¬
"PostScript Level " & PPDLevel & return & "PPD Path: " & PPDPath & return & 
return ¬
& screensText & return & return & PPDSpotFunctionText as string
make new text frame in document 1 ¬
Property
Value type
What it is
file path
File object
Path specification for the PPD file.
language level
Unicode text
The PostScript language level.
screens
list of 
separation screen
List of color separation screens.
spot functions
list of 
screen spot function
List of color separation screen spot functions.
C
HAPTER
1: AppleScript Objects
PPD properties     157
with properties {contents:textContents, position:{20, 700}}
end tell
C
HAPTER
1: AppleScript Objects
print options     158
print options
Collects all print options when printing a document with the print
command.
print options object properties
Property
Value type
What it is
color management 
settings
color management 
options
The printing color management options.
color separation 
settings
color separation 
options
The printing color separation options.
coordinate settings
coordinate 
options
The printing coordinate options.
flattener preset
Unicode text
The transparency flattener preset name.
flattener settings
flattening 
options
The printing flattener options.
font settings
font options
The printing font options.
job settings
job options
The printing job options.
page marks settings
page marks 
options
The printing page marks options.
paper settings
paper options
The paper options.
postscript settings
postscript 
options
The printing PostScript options.
PPD name
Unicode text
The name of the PPD file.
print preset
Unicode text
The name of the printer preset to use.
printer name
Unicode text
The printer name.
C
HAPTER
1: AppleScript Objects
print options     159
Print with options
-- Make new document. add symbol items
-- Set job options, color management options, coordinate options, flattening options
-- Print the document using these options
tell application "Adobe Illustrator"
activate
make new document
repeat with i from 1 to (count of symbols in document 1)
round (i / 2 - (round (i / 2) rounding down)) rounding up
make new symbol item in document 1 with properties ¬
{symbol:symbol i of document 1, position:{100 + (the result * 150), (50 + i * 
70)}} ¬
end repeat
set jobOptions to {class:job options, designation:all layers, reverse pages:true} ¬
set colorOptions to {class:color management options, name:"ColorMatch RGB", 
intent:saturation} ¬
set coordinateOptions to {class:coordinate options, fit to page:true}
set flatteningOptions to ¬
{class:flattening options, clip complex regions:true, gradient resolution:60, 
rasterization resolution:60} ¬
set printOptions to ¬
¬
{class:print options, job settings:jobOptions, color management 
settings:colorOptions, coordinate settings:coordinateOptions, flattener 
settings:flatteningOptions} ¬
print document 1 options printOptions
end tell
C
HAPTER
1: AppleScript Objects
printer     160
printer
Associates an installed printer with a printer configuration object.
printer object properties
Listing printers
-- Make a new documet
-- Get the name of every printer
-- Display the list of names
tell application "Adobe Illustrator"
set printerList to ""
activate
make new document
set textRef to make new text frame in current document
if printers is not {} then
name of every item of printers as list
repeat with theName in the result
set printerList to printerList & theName & return
end repeat
set theText to printerList
set position of textRef to {200, 600}
else
set theText to "No installed printers"
end if
set contents of textRef to theText
end tell
Property
Value type
What it is
name
Unicode text
The printer name.
properties
printer properties
The printer information.
Documents you may be interested
Documents you may be interested